Windows 11 22H2 is now available in the Release Preview channel

Microsoft today released Windows 11, version 22H2 to all insiders in the Release Preview channel. It is also available on devices enrolled in the Windows Insider program for Business. They receive the same build 22621 which is known to be RTM.

Regular participants (i.e. consumers) can get version 22H2 using the "seeker" experience in Settings > Windows Update. This means the update offer remains optional.

To show the installation option, the device must meet Windows 11 hardware requirements. If so, on the Windows Update page, there will be an option to download and install Windows 11, version 22H2 Build 22621.

Once an Insider updates their PC to Windows 11, version 22H2, they will continue to automatically receive new servicing updates through Windows Update (the typical monthly update process).

Also, Microsoft notes that commercial devices, if configured to receive updates from the RP channel via Settings, Group Policy, or Intune, will be offered to install version 22H2. System administrators can use it to validate customer configurations and hardware compatibility with the newest Windows 11 release.

Windows 11, version 22H2 is also now available via Windows Server Update Service and Azure Marketplace.

Microsoft also offers free support for Windows 11 Pro, Enterprise, and Education editions. Devices with these editions must belong to an organization, e.g. be part of a domain.
